WOOD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2025 in Review

79 of the 8,223 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Global Timber & Forestry ETF (WOOD) for Q4 2025, worth a combined $64.4M — down 6.8% from $69.1M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 9 funds closed out of WOOD and 7 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 19 trimmed existing stakes and 26 added.

The largest buyer was 1832 Asset Management, adding an estimated $1.13M. The largest seller was Wealth Enhancement Advisory Services, cutting an estimated $5.53M.
